    Been running superchips in the Williams for a long while now. Paid about 130pounds for mine. Better driveability and improves the flat spot around 3k-4k. I estimate 5bhp to 10 bhp improvements past 3k rpm and slightly fatter torque curves all round.

    IMHO, with non-dyno remapped chips, you can't expect much as the mapping was done blind and thus have to be set conservatively. I think real-time dyno remaps is the way forward these days.
